Myths Concerning LASIK Pain
Unlike popular belief, LASIK surgical treatment isn't as excruciating as many people assume. The treatment itself is reasonably quick and pain-free. You might really feel some pressure or discomfort throughout the surgical procedure, but it's typically marginal. The doctor will certainly utilize numbing eye drops to make sure that you don't really feel any discomfort throughout the process.
While it's normal to experience some dry skin, irritation, or mild pain in the hours following the surgical procedure, this can usually be managed with over-the-counter discomfort medication and eye decreases. It is essential to follow your physician's post-operative care guidelines to decrease any kind of pain and promote appropriate recovery.

Threats Related To LASIK
Several people undertaking LASIK surgical treatment are mostly worried about possible dangers related to the treatment. While Click At this website is a secure and reliable treatment for vision Correction, like any kind of surgical procedure, it does include some risks.
One of the most common dangers connected with LASIK consist of dry eyes, glow, halos, and difficulty driving at evening in the immediate postoperative duration. These symptoms are normally momentary and boost as the eyes heal.
In rare instances, more major problems such as infection, corneal flap concerns, and vision loss can take place, but the likelihood of these difficulties is incredibly reduced when the surgical treatment is done by a knowledgeable and experienced eye doctor. It's important to review these dangers with your physician throughout the appointment to ensure you have a clear understanding of what to expect.
Eligibility Misconceptions

While LASIK is typically associated with treating high levels of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ism, people with milder vision problems can additionally be eligible candidates. In fact, advancements in LASIK technology have increased the series of treatable prescriptions, enabling even more people to benefit from the treatment.
LASIK qualification is determined with a thorough eye examination by a certified eye doctor. Variables such as corneal density, eye health and wellness, and total case history play a vital function in evaluating an individual's suitability for the surgical procedure.
Even individuals over 40, that may have presbyopia (age-related trouble concentrating on close things), can potentially go through LASIK or various other vision Correction treatments.
